Job Description

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Vendor Management: Manage 8-10 cab vendors, ensuring timely delivery of services and adherence to SLAs.
  2. Spot Rental Cab Requests: Handle 1000-2000 monthly cab spot rental requests, ensuring efficient allocation and timely fulfillment.
  3. Business Management: Manage a monthly cab spot rental business of 25-50 lakhs, analyzing data to identify areas for improvement and opportunities for growth.
  4. Vendor Connect: Conduct monthly reviews with vendors to improve service levels, address concerns, and ensure zero escalations.
  5. Audit and Compliance: Perform daily cab and service level audits, ensuring adherence to standards and regulations.
  6. Service Level Management: Monitor and manage service parameters, SLAs, and TATs, ensuring high-quality service delivery.
  7. Problem-Solving: Identify improvement areas, resolve issues, and implement solutions to enhance service delivery.
  8. Proposal Development: Create proposals and solutions for users, ensuring tailored services meet their needs.
  9. Invoice Management: Ensure accuracy of invoices, resolving any discrepancies or issues promptly.
  10. Data Analysis: Analyze data to identify trends, areas for improvement, and opportunities for service enhancement.
  11. Communication: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to interact with vendors, users, and higher management.

Requirements:

1. Experience:

10+ years of experience in handling cab vendors, reconciliation, and spot rental cab requests.

2. Qualification:

Graduate degree from a recognized university Accounting background will be added advantage

3. Skills:

  • Proficient in Excel (VLOOKUP, Pivot Tables)
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work in shifts and manage multiple tasks

4. Other Requirements:

  •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Proactive approach to email management and vendor communication
